For Initial Setup on Android and iOS Devices:

  1. Download and Install WhatsApp: Begin by downloading WhatsApp from the Google Play Store or Apple App Store, depending on your device. Once downloaded, proceed with the installation process.
  2. Open WhatsApp: Launch the application on your smartphone. You will be prompted to enter your phone number during the initial setup phase.
  3. Enter Your Phone Number: In the provided field, input your phone number including the country code. For example, if you are in the United States, you would start with +1 followed by your area code and the rest of your number.
  4. Verify Your Phone Number: After entering your phone number, WhatsApp will send a verification code via SMS to the number you provided. This code is essential for confirming your identity and activating your account.
  5. Enter the Verification Code: Once you receive the SMS with the verification code, enter it into the designated field within the WhatsApp app.

Tips for Accurate Entry:

  • Country Code: Always ensure that you prefix your phone number with the correct country code (e.g., +1 for the United States).
  • Formatting: Some countries have specific formatting requirements for phone numbers, so make sure to follow these guidelines.
  • International Numbers: If you are adding an international contact, ensure that both the country code and the area code are included in the correct format.
